Why is it called 27 Clouds?
According to the U.S. National Weather Service there are 27 categories of clouds.
"Clouds are identified based upon your observation point at your elevation. From sea-level, you might observe stratus clouds enveloping the top of a mountain. However, if you were on the mountain top and in that same cloud, you would observe and report fog."
It's all about your point of view. We all know that travel broadens the mind and 27 Clouds' remit is to showcase the widest and most eclectic view of travel and travel related topics from all over the world.
